  • Patent number: 7554974
    Abstract: Methods and systems for performing stateful signaling transactions in a distributed processing environment are disclosed. A method for performing stateful signaling transactions in a distributed processing environment includes receiving a signaling message at a routing node, such as a signal transfer point. The signaling message is distributed to one of the plurality of stateful processing modules. The receiving stateful processing module buffers the signaling message and initiates a stateful transaction based on the signaling message. Initiating the stateful transaction may include generating a query message and inserting a stateful processing module identifier in the query message. The query message is sent to an external node, such as an SCP, which formulates a response. The SCP may insert the stateful processing module in the response and send the response back to the signal transfer point.

  • Patent number: 7190959
    Abstract: Methods and systems for processing messages at a first network node in a mobile communications network are disclosed. A first message relating to a communication in a mobile communications network that includes a called directory number is received. A lookup is performed in a first database based on the called directory number to determine whether a called party has been ported out of a first network and to determine a migration status of the called party. In response to determining that the called party has been ported out of the first network, a first reply message is formulated including first routing information from the first database that indicates a second network to which the called party has been ported. If the called party has not been ported out, a second reply message is formulated including second routing information from the first database that corresponds to the determined migration status.

  • Publication number: 20050240862
    Abstract: A method is disclosed for displaying a plurality of statistical data usually presented in a histogram, such as sample counts and percentages of a collection of categorized samples, in a compact single table. The method comprises presenting grouped statistical data that exists within a collection of “buckets” and presenting the sample count for the collected data as an integer in a corresponding cell in the table. Additionally, as disclosed by the present invention, the percentage value of the samples located in each bucket data cell is represented in the data cell as a superimposed gray-scale representation. Presenting the percentages in gray-scale provides overall clarity to the table, assists in ensuring that data can be quickly and easily interpreted and not be subject to misinterpretation, and further allows for the compact display of such information in a single table and subsequent manipulation by automated analysis tools.

  • Publication number: 20050045591
    Abstract: A method of treating a molybdenum (moly) mask used in a C4 process to pattern C4 contacts. The moly mask has a wafer side which contacts a wafer during the C4 process and has a rough surface that includes spikes/projections of moly. The moly mask also has a non wafer side and a plurality of holes extending through the mask to pattern C4 contacts in the C4 process. An adhesive layer, such as an adhesive tape, is applied to the non wafer side of the moly mask, to enable a polishing tool to pull a vacuum on the non wafer side of the moly mask in spite of the presence of the holes to secure the moly mask during a subsequent polishing step. The tape also functions as a cushion so that defects on the non wafer side of the moly mask do not replicate through the moly mask to the polished wafer side of the moly mask.
